Theme Demo Import [theme-demo-import] < 1.1.1

unknown

[en] Theme Demo Import WordPress plugin before 1.1.1 does not validate the imported file, allowing high-privilege users such as admin to upload arbitrary files (such as PHP) even when FILE_MODS and FILE_EDIT are disallowed.

Affected:
up to 1.1.1
Fixed in:
1.1.1
Disclosed:
Jan 16, 2024

CVE-2022-1538 on NVD →

Theme Demo Import <= 1.1.3 - Authenticated (Administrator+) Arbitrary File Upload

high

The Theme Demo Import pl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to arbitrary file uploads in versions up to, and including, 1.1.3.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ers with administrator privileges to upload arbitrary files on the affected site's server which may make remote code execution possible.

CVSS:
7.2
Affected:
up to 1.1.3
Fix:
No patched version reported
Disclosed:
Aug 9, 2023

CVE-2023-28170 on NVD →
